OTLK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2020 in Review

22 of the 4,538 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Outlook Therapeutics (OTLK) for Q1 2020, worth a combined $3.6M — up 316% from $865K a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 13 funds opened new OTLK positions and 6 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 3 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Sabby Management, adding an estimated $2.36M. The largest seller was Renaissance Technologies, exiting entirely with an estimated $23K sold.
